The largest industries in Douglas County, NE are Health Care & Social Assistance (45,681 people), Retail Trade (31,566 people), and Finance & Insurance (26,858 people), and the highest paying industries are Utilities ($82,385), Mining, Quarrying, & Oil & Gas Extraction ($69,028), and Professional, Scientific, & Technical Services ($60,684). In 2020, the tract with the highest Median Household Income (Total) in Douglas County, NE was Census Tract 75.14 with a value of $179,621, followed by Census Tract 68.04 and Census Tract 75.09, with respective values of $171,518 and $163,042.
